Is a heat pump worth it in Ashland?
In Ashland, a heat pump would cost more to run each year than what you have now. $3,500 is what Ashland would pay extra to go electric rather than replace the furnace and AC with the same again, once the $2,000 federal credit is applied. Unfortunately the electric bill outweighs the gas bill it replaces by about $55 a year here, so the extra spend stays unrecovered. That's Ashland's own climate and rates talking, not a hedge or a caveat.
Ashland's weather, in the numbers that matter
Degree days tell the story here: Ashland racks up 4955 heating degree days each year (base 65°F), and summers add a moderate cooling load, with 965 cooling degree days on the cooling side. Sizing runs off the design temperature, not the average day: 1°F here (record low -2.9°F), which works out to a seasonal COP of 2.72 for the cold-climate class of unit this climate calls for. Ashland needs the cold-climate class of unit: past a 25°F design temperature a standard heat pump falls back on resistance backup often enough to eat the savings. Source: NOAA station MANSFIELD LAHM REGIONAL AIRPO, 11.1 miles from Ashland — the closest one on record.
What it actually costs to run, year to year
Modelled on a typical 2000-square-foot house, the heat pump draws about 4,613 kWh a year to keep it warm, plus cooling, for a combined electric bill near $1,000 a year. That compares with roughly 52 Mcf a year of gas at Ashland's 13.85 per-Mcf rate — about $945 a year — against a local electricity rate of 18.40¢/kWh. Buy it outright, not incrementally, and payback stretches to beyond the 15-year equipment life; over 15 years the net position sits $4,330 behind.
Electric resistance heat in Ashland, compared
Plenty of homes in Ashland heat with electricity alone, no gas line involved. Against electric-resistance heat — baseboard or an electric furnace, both 100% efficient but still just resistance — the case for switching gets stronger here. Switching saves about $1,539 a year here — a heat pump moving heat rather than generating it needs far less electricity than resistance coils — so the extra $8,000 spent up front comes back in about 5.2 years.
